When should I do an ultrasound in the 2nd trimester of pregnancy?
Ultrasound diagnostics at this stage can be carried out both routinely (from 18 to 21 weeks), and additionally (if certain doubts or threats arise). Indications at this stage are determination of:
- number of fetuses;
- position in the uterus, size and growth;
- general development, proportionality of all parts of the body;
- structure of the heart, frequency of its contractions;
- structure of the placenta;
- tone of the uterus;
- condition of the cervical canal.

Ultrasound examination in the second trimester of pregnancy is a valuable diagnostic that will help monitor the development of the child, the presence of pathologies. If necessary, the doctor can prescribe the optimal treatment in order to prevent the development of complications and maintain the pregnancy.
When assessing existing sizes with standard indicators, individual characteristics and hereditary factors are also taken into account. Small deviations from generally accepted indicators can gradually return to normal, this should not be frightening, but control and observation by a specialist is mandatory.
Screening: ultrasound of the 2nd trimester of pregnancy. Preparation
Unlike the first trimester, in the second there is no need to follow a diet, or fill the bladder, since the size of the uterus is quite large and adjacent organs no longer interfere with a full examination.
